In their book “Analytic Combinatorics”, Flajolet and Sedgewick describe a general approach that starts from a combinatorial description, translates this description into equations satisfied by generating functions, views these generating functions as analytic functions and exploits their singular behavior to deduce asymptotic properties of the combinatorial objects when their size becomes large.

With Bruno Salvy, we developed computational tools that automate large parts of this approach and in this talk I will outline the main steps.
